How do I stop repeated Dell Update messages?
I uninstalled Dell Support Center a long time ago, but I still get Dell Update messages popping up in the system tray area from time to time (like every day, several times a day, this past week, and staring me in the face right now). Invariably, if I try to allow whatever it is to install the updates, they fail, without specifying why (which is another issue, but secondary for now), and so the message keeps popping up. I want to prevent these automatic updates from Dell entirely, and just periodically check for updates on my own, but the instructions I found in this forum for preventing updates all refer to either removing the Support Center program—which, as I said, I removed long ago—or disabling the sprtcmd service, which is not running. The only Dell service that I see running is Dell Client Management Services. Will stopping that prevent these Dell Update messages, or will that just stop my computer from functioning? (Or neither?) If not, any other suggestions for stopping these annoying messages?

on my laptop I set Dell Client Management Services to manual and never seen a popup.
by setting the service to manual you can still run dell update if you want or need to.
